The Speech-Language Pathologist, with an unrestricted Massachusetts license with a minimum of 2 years experience in neonatal/early intervention care, is responsible for providing evaluation and treatment services to neonates through three years of life who are referred with swallowing, speech, language developmental disorders and/or risk for developmental delay. Services are provided on an inpatient and outpatient basis (at BWH NICU, newborn nursery, and/or ambulatory follow-up clinic).
Provides skilled speech-language and swallowing services as assigned to patients at Brigham and Women's Hospital in accordance with State Licensure Statute and Regulations, Professional Standards of Practice and Code of Ethics, applicable federal, state and regulatory agencies' standards and regulations, hospital and departmental policies and procedures.
